Ethereum Exodus: Whales Withdraw $64 Million ETH From Exchanges, Bullish Signal?

Share This Post

According to data from Lookonchain, an on-chain analytics platform, Ethereum (ETH), whales have withdrawn roughly $64.2 million worth of ETH from major exchanges.

This significant movement of funds coincides with a notable uptick in the price of ETH, indicating an increasing interest in the asset.

Ethereum Whales Movement Signals Confidence

According to Lookonchain’s findings, much of the ETH supply has been shifted from exchange wallets to custodial wallets. The on-chain analytics platform reported that an Ethereum address labeled 0x8B94 had withdrawn an amount of 14,632 ETH, valued at approximately $45.5 million, from Binance.

Lookonchain states these funds have been actively staked within six days, indicating a deliberate move towards adopting long-term investment strategies.

The analysis from the platform also points out that another two fresh whale wallets have transferred 6,000 ETH, amounting to $18.7 million, from Kraken to undisclosed wallet addresses over the last two days.

This trend suggests an increase in major investors to secure substantial amounts of Ethereum away from exchange platforms, potentially as a means of positioning for long-term asset appreciation.

Further echoing this is a recent analysis from CryptoQuant’s Quicktake, which underscores a notable trend regarding Ethereum withdrawals from exchanges over the past few weeks. This observation relies on the “Exchange Reserve” metric, which monitors the quantity of ETH tokens held in the wallets of all centralized exchanges.

When the value of this metric increases, it signifies that investors are depositing more assets than withdrawing them from centralized exchanges, indicating a buildup of Ethereum reserves. Conversely, a decline in the metric suggests a net outflow of assets from these platforms.

According to data from CryptoQuant, over 800,000 ETH, equivalent to roughly $2.4 billion, has exited cryptocurrency exchanges since the beginning of the year. Such substantial outflows from these platforms typically indicate a surge in investor confidence in the Ethereum network and its native token.

Ethereum’s Price Momentum And Potential For A Significant Breakout

Meanwhile, Ethereum’s price has displayed bullish momentum, witnessing a 5.5% increase in the past week and reclaiming the crucial $3,000 mark.

Financial guru Raoul Pal has drawn attention to Ethereum’s potential for a major breakout, pointing to a “dual-chart pattern” observed on the ETH/BTC chart.

Pal highlights a “mega wedge” pattern alongside an inner descending channel, indicating a consolidation phase with bullish potential.
